Cranial base hemorrhage. A technique for controlling the uncontrollable.

Summary
This study introduces an autologous bone grafting technique to control severe cranial base hemorrhage, a life-threatening surgical emergency. This method offers a novel solution for managing bleeding when direct vessel control is impossible, potentially reducing trauma mortality.
Area of Science:
- Trauma surgery
- Surgical hemostasis
- Neurosurgery
Background:
- Life-threatening hemorrhage control is critical in trauma management.
- Hemorrhage from the cranial base presents unique challenges due to its inaccessibility.
- Direct control of transected cranial base vessels is often not feasible.
Observation:
- Severe hemorrhage from the cranial base is a demanding surgical emergency.
- Standard methods for hemorrhage control may be insufficient for cranial base injuries.
- Autologous bone grafting was explored as a potential hemostatic technique.
Findings:
- An autologous bone grafting technique was successfully employed to control severe cranial base hemorrhage.
- This method provides a viable option for managing bleeding when direct vessel ligation is not possible.
- Literature review suggests this technique may be a novel approach.
Implications:
- This technique could offer a new strategy for managing intractable cranial base bleeding.
- Successful application may improve outcomes and reduce mortality in severe trauma cases.
- Further research is warranted to validate and explore the broader applicability of this method.
